Handover — Schemary event registry, on-call notes. Producers register Avro schemas at publish time; compatibility checks run in strict mode. Most pages are compatibility rejections from the Trellix billing pipeline — contact their on-call rather than overriding. Registry state lives in the consensus store; never edit it directly. If the service restarts, confirm it came up with the configuration values below.

deployment values, yadug-bawif:
[framir]
team = pelox
access_code = ac_a38ab2
owner = tamion.julael
host = framir.tolvaqlabs.test
port = 11211
peer = tammir.zemvargrid.local
salt = 2215ef03
pin = 1541

## FY Headcount Plan — Managers Only

Vellorn Systems plans 42 net new hires next year. Engineering gets 24, split between the Corval platform and QA. Sales adds 10, all in the Drellmark region. Ops and finance share the remaining 8. Backfills are capped at attrition minus two. No contractor conversions before Q3. Budget assumes blended fully-loaded cost per the finance model; variances above 3% need VP sign-off. Freeze triggers apply if Q2 bookings miss plan. Context for finance follows below.

internal memo for tajof-kagef: The western region missed its Ulaius quota by 32.0 percent last quarter. Kasoxek Freight plans to lower the Eliiel list price by 64.7 percent in November. The board signed off on a budget of $266.8 million for Project Istwyn. The renewal with Wenmirix Logistics closes at $502.9 million a year, 11.8 percent below the last contract.

## Session Handling for Health Checks

The Corvel gateway sits behind the Lanternside load balancer, which probes /healthz every ten seconds. Health-check requests are stateless by design: they bypass the session store entirely so that probe traffic never inflates session counts or evicts real user sessions. New team members should note that the deep-check endpoint, /healthz/deep, does verify session-store connectivity and therefore requires authentication. When probing it manually, supply the token below.

bearer token for tajep-kajef: eyJhbGciOiJIUzI1NiIsInR5cCI6IkpXVCJ9.eyJzdWIiOiIoOsZ23In0.CsygO0hs